Block Work Repair in Cleveland, OH
Block work repair services involve restoring and maintaining structures built with concrete blocks, bricks, or similar materials. These repairs are commonly needed for retaining walls, garden borders, basement foundations, and other load-bearing or decorative features around residential properties. Property owners typically seek this service to address issues such as cracked or crumbling blocks, displaced or leaning walls, and damage caused by weather, settling, or age. Understanding the extent of damage, the type of block material, and the desired outcome can help homeowners communicate their needs effectively when requesting repairs.
Before requesting block work repair services, homeowners should assess the scope of the project, including identifying visible damage and any underlying structural concerns. It’s important to consider whether repairs will be cosmetic or structural, as this influences the approach and materials used. Clear information about the existing wall condition, the type of blocks involved, and any previous repairs can assist in planning an effective solution. Proper evaluation ensures that repairs will restore stability, improve appearance, and prevent future issues.

Common Block Work Repair Jobs
Block wall repairs - restoring damaged or cracked brick and concrete walls to ensure stability.
Mortar joint repointing - renewing deteriorated mortar to prevent water intrusion and maintain wall integrity.
Cracked or bowed wall fixes - addressing structural issues caused by settling or shifting foundations.
Stone and brick replacement - replacing broken or missing blocks to restore appearance and strength.
Efflorescence removal - cleaning mineral deposits that can weaken masonry surfaces over time.
Drainage and waterproofing - improving water management around walls to prevent future damage.
Block Work Repair Questions
What types of block work repairs are common? Repairs often involve fixing cracked or damaged concrete blocks, replacing deteriorated mortar, or restoring structural stability of walls and foundations.
How can I tell if my block wall need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, bulging or leaning walls, or water leaks that indicate underlying damage requiring attention.
What are typical projects for block work repair? Projects include restoring retaining walls, repairing basement walls, or fixing damaged garden or boundary walls.
Why is timely repair important for block work? Prompt repairs help prevent further deterioration, maintain structural integrity, and avoid more costly fixes later on.
